Reporting on vacant New York city housing authority dwelling units.
A Local Law to amend the administrative code of the city of New York, in relation to reporting on vacant New York city housing authority dwelling units
This bill would require the Mayor, or an agency or office designated by the Mayor, to publish online and submit to the Council an annual report on NYCHA dwelling units that were vacant during the immediately preceding calendar year. The report would include, among other things, the number of vacant dwelling units, including the number of such units that are located in seniors-only developments, contain accessibility features, were recategorized as non-dwelling units, or tested positive for a hazardous substance. The report would also include other metrics such as the average vacancy length, various vacancy statuses and reasons for vacancy, and NYCHA’s efforts to promptly occupy vacant units. The report would also require information about vacancies in PACT developments, if available. The first report would be due no later than March 1, 2027.
